Description
This Beef Seven-Bone Roast is fall-apart tender, making it a perfect dish for family dinners and gatherings.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 seven-bone roast
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 2 teaspoons salt
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up beef broth
- 2 onions, quartered
- 3 carrots, chopped
- 2 celery stalks, chopped
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 325°F (163°C).
- Rub the roast with olive oil, salt, and black pepper.
- In a large roasting pan, place the quartered onions, carrots, and celery at the bottom.
- Place the seasoned roast on top of the vegetables.
- Add minced garlic around the roast and pour beef broth into the pan.
- Cover the pan with foil and roast in the preheated oven for 3-4 hours, or until the meat is tender.
- Remove from oven and let it rest before slicing.
Notes
- For extra flavor, marinate the roast overnight in the refrigerator.
- Serve with your favorite sides for a hearty meal.
